WebCan I eat canned sardines without cooking? Eat sardines straight out of the can . You don't need a complicated recipe to enjoy sardines ! Simply grab a fork and eat them straight out of the can for a healthy, protein-packed snack. You could add a drizzle of lemon juice, hot sauce, or balsamic vinaigrette on top if you want.
